The art world lost one of its most influential figures today: Marian Goodman, the legendary gallerist who shaped contemporary art's institutional rise, died at 97. Her death creates immediate questions for collectors holding work by her roster—Gerhard Richter, Steve McQueen, William Kentridge, Pierre Huyghe—as gallery succession and representation stability will directly impact pricing over the next 12-24 months. This comes as the primary market shows signs of contraction, with dealers and fairs announcing 'strategic pauses' that suggest defensive positioning ahead.
